Output f2fe4e23988528d4cb084c95e13dce06ea988f232b9395ab5c7404cf04ea951c:50

value
104552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f1e86fd709164460a69d684053e3cd201e60e1 OP_EQUAL
address
3QZteZUw8J8J4B5YAF8BHfK9xLcxS8Epmn
transaction
f2fe4e23988528d4cb084c95e13dce06ea988f232b9395ab5c7404cf04ea951c
confirmations
191747
spent
true